Output 3768e10500eda220b13c880561fc9afc6a373f25c76690dcd5ba1c6344df3315:1

value
156350270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fd54d9f36b7784efcebfe1fcef71c96af35bfc7 OP_EQUAL
address
34bLQ4HLBjUwZ8JpAqkdMNDWosfxBhrsq8
transaction
3768e10500eda220b13c880561fc9afc6a373f25c76690dcd5ba1c6344df3315
spent
true